      <title>6 Common Causes of Drywall Damage and How Professionals Repair Them</title>

          1. Moisture and Water Damage
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Spotting water damage in drywall is not always straightforward, as it often occurs behind walls. Signs to look for include discoloration, bloating, and soft spots on drywall surfaces. Water-damaged drywall may appear yellow or brown, and in some cases, it may even develop a musty odor from mold growth. Shrinkage or warping in drywall components can also indicate water damage, requiring closer inspection by professionals. Effective identification not only prevents further deterioration but also promotes accurate and comprehensive repairs.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Repairing water-damaged drywall typically involves replacing the affected sections and treating the area to prevent mold growth. Drywall contractors cut out damaged areas and replace them with new material for a seamless blend with existing structures. They also apply mold-resistant treatments to the surrounding area to prevent recurrence. Proper sealing and insulation are critical in this process to safeguard against future moisture issues.           2. Poor Installation Practices
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Signs of poor installation typically become apparent as the structure settles or under minor pressure. For instance, visible seams, popping nails, and uneven surfaces are clear indicators of subpar work. Additionally, drywall that rattles or creaks under pressure often suggests inadequate securing to the framework. Such symptoms signal the need for a professional evaluation to diagnose the extent of the problem. Recognizing these signs early can prevent more significant issues from developing, such as complete wall failure.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Repairing installation flaws may involve removing and reinstalling problematic sections of drywall. If the issue is due to inadequate securing, professionals may remedy it by applying additional fasteners in the correct configuration. For surface imperfections, skimming compounds can provide a smoother finish and corrected appearance. Alternatively, complete replacement of compromised sections will provide the highest integrity.           3. Physical Impact and Accidental Damage
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Assessing damage extent in such scenarios involves inspecting the drywall for dents, holes, or surface cracks. For smaller impacts, the damage is often superficial and involves merely the outer paper covering of the drywall. Larger holes, however, may reveal internal structure compromise or damage to insulation material behind the wall. Professional assessment often involves probing the wall surface and interior to evaluate the full breadth of damage. Such examinations allow for tailored repair strategies that address both visible and concealed damage efficiently.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Small dents and superficial damage to drywall can typically be repaired with simple patching techniques. Drywall contractors often use spackle or joint compound to fill in indentations, followed by sanding for a smooth finish. An appropriate finish texture is then applied to match the existing wall for a seamless repair. In some cases, applying a primer and paint serves to fully integrate the repaired area with its surroundings. Repairing large holes or cracks requires more involved approaches than small dents. This type of repair often necessitates cutting out the damaged section and replacing it with a new piece of drywall. The patch is affixed with joint tape and joint compound, which is sanded to a smooth finish after drying.

          4. Settlement and Structural Movement
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Indicators of ongoing settlement and structural movement often appear visibly in drywall as cracks, gaps, or misalignment of architectural elements. Uneven floors, sticking doors, or windows are additional signals that structural movement may be occurring. While some minor cracks may simply be due to natural settling, significant or rapidly developing signs warrant professional inspection. Continuous monitoring is advised to differentiate between settlement-related issues and those stemming from other causes, allowing for accurate diagnostics. An informed evaluation prevents misinterpretation and allows for effective solution application.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Tackling settlement-related drywall cracks can range from cosmetic fixes to significant structural repairs. For minor cracks that don't affect the wall's structural role, filling with appropriate filler materials and repainting can suffice. In cases where wall separations or larger cracks exist, professional repair may require backer rods, crack isolation systems, or even reshoring techniques. This guarantees that repairs accommodate any further natural shifts the building may experience.           6. Temperature and Humidity Fluctuations
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Humidity levels also play a crucial role in the condition of drywall, affecting its longevity and appearance. Excessive humidity causes drywall to absorb moisture, potentially leading to swelling, sagging, or even mold growth on surfaces. Conversely, overly dry environments can make drywall brittle, causing cracks to form more easily. Identifying and regulating humidity changes staves off potential drywall damage, supporting consistent integrity. Homeowners must strike a balance in maintaining humidity levels to protect their investments.
         &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
          Addressing humidity and temperature effects might involve treating or replacing areas of the drywall prone to damage. For instance, cracks induced by temperature response may need straightforward filling, while larger structural issues necessitate comprehensive replacement. Professionals may apply moisture-resistant paints or coatings to mitigate recurrence due to extreme humidity. Quality repair effectively restores wall health, but often must be combined with ongoing environmental regulation. Consistent temperature and humidity controls complement these repairs, preventing future erosion by environmental elements.

          1. Noticing Visible Cracks Spreading Across Walls
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Small hairline cracks may not always signal a major issue, but widespread or expanding cracks are a different story. If you see cracks running diagonally from doors and windows or long horizontal fractures across entire walls, your drywall may be under stress. Structural settling, moisture intrusion, or improper installation can all cause these problems. In many cases, these expanding cracks are early warning signs of deeper structural movement that should be evaluated before more extensive damage occurs.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Over time, cracks can widen and allow air leaks, moisture, and even pests to enter the wall cavity. Simply patching over them repeatedly may provide temporary relief, but recurring cracks often indicate deeper damage. When repairs fail to hold, it may be time to consult drywall services about full panel replacement rather than continued cosmetic fixes.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;h3&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          2. Seeing Water Stains or Discoloration Forming
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Water stains are one of the clearest signs that drywall has been compromised. Yellow, brown, or gray discoloration often points to leaks from plumbing, roofing, or condensation buildup. Once drywall absorbs moisture, it weakens and can lose its structural integrity.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          In some cases, the drywall may feel soft or spongy to the touch. Even if the surface appears dry, internal damage may remain. If stains continue to reappear after addressing a leak, replacing the affected sections is usually more effective than repainting.           3. Discovering Mold Growth Behind the Surface
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Mold thrives in damp, dark environments, making drywall an ideal breeding ground when moisture is present. You may notice a musty odor before you see visible spots. Dark patches, fuzzy growth, or bubbling paint can all signal mold contamination.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Surface cleaning may not eliminate mold that has penetrated deeply into the drywall core. In these cases, removal is often the safest solution. Mold can pose health risks, particularly for individuals with allergies or respiratory conditions. Replacing affected drywall panels eliminates the source and allows for proper remediation of the underlying moisture problem.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;h3&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          4. Feeling Soft Spots or Sagging Areas
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Drywall should feel firm and solid. If you press gently against a wall and notice movement, softness, or sagging, the material may be deteriorating. This is especially common in ceilings exposed to leaks or high humidity.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Sagging drywall can eventually collapse, posing a safety risk. Ceilings with visible bowing or separation from framing should be evaluated immediately.           5. Observing Frequent Nail Pops or Fastener Issues
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Nail pops occur when drywall fasteners push outward, creating small bumps or circles on the surface. While occasional nail pops are common as homes settle, repeated or widespread fastener issues may indicate shifting framing or poor installation.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          If you continue repairing the same areas and new pops appear nearby, the drywall may no longer be securely anchored. Persistent fastener problems can weaken the overall wall system. Replacing the affected sections allows for proper fastening and finishing, ensuring a smoother, longer-lasting result.

          6. Experiencing Persistent Holes and Surface Damage
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Accidental impacts from furniture, doorknobs, or everyday activity can leave holes in drywall. Small dents are usually repairable, but large holes or multiple damaged areas across a wall may warrant replacement.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;br/&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          When patchwork becomes extensive, the wall may look uneven or poorly blended despite repainting. Replacing an entire sheet can provide a cleaner, more cohesive appearance. According to The Spruce, drywall for walls typically measures 4 feet by 8 feet, though 12-foot lengths are also available. Installing a full panel rather than piecing together multiple patches often creates a more seamless finish and improves durability.

        The Importance of Proper Surface Preparation
       
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              &#xD;
&l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Proper surface preparation is the foundation of effective sheetrock taping. The initial step involves cleaning and dusting the drywall surface to ensure no debris interferes with the adhesion of tape and joint compound. Failure to remove dust can lead to imperfections, jeopardizing the smooth finish that sheetrock taping aims to achieve. Using a damp cloth or a vacuum with a brush attachment can help mitigate dust-related problems. Regular cleaning routines not only streamline the taping process but also enhance the longevity of the finish.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Ensuring optimal joint conditions is crucial for effective taping. This involves checking the fit of drywall panels and making necessary adjustments to minimize gaps and irregularities. Any protruding nails or screws need to be set below the surface to avoid hindering the taping process. The use of a level can aid in identifying imperfections, allowing for precise corrections. Consistent application of these practices ensures a sound base for the taping process.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Priming the drywall with quality materials forms another critical step. Choosing a suitable primer helps in creating a uniform surface that facilitates better adhesion of joint compounds. Quality primers seal the porous surface of sheetrock, preventing moisture absorption that can compromise the taping process. Investing in premium primers offers a discernible difference, particularly when seeking professional results. The choice of primer should be compatible with both the drywall and the environmental conditions of the project site.

        Understanding the Types of Joint Tapes
       
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              &#xD;
&l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Diving into the types of joint tapes, each offers unique benefits that cater to specific applications. Paper tape, for instance, is favored for its strength and ability to create smooth, seamless finishes. Conversely, mesh tape is appreciated for its self-adhesive nature, simplifying the application process. The choice between paper and mesh tapes hinges on factors such as project complexity and user proficiency. Understanding these nuances allows for informed decisions, aligning tape choices with project goals.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Evaluating moisture resistance is imperative when selecting the appropriate joint tape. High-moisture environments demand tapes with enhanced water-resistant properties to prevent issues such as mold growth and tape degradation. Fiberglass tape, known for its excellent moisture resistance, is often recommended in bathrooms and kitchens. The durability of tapes under varying moisture conditions determines the lifespan and quality of the finished wall. Selecting the right tape based on environmental exposure safeguards both the appearance and efficacy of the completed installation.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Cost and aesthetic considerations also play crucial roles in tape selection. Paper tapes tend to be more affordable, an appealing factor for budget-conscious projects, while mesh tapes might incur additional costs. However, the initial investment in higher-priced tapes can yield long-term benefits, including reduced maintenance and repair costs. Understanding the cost implications and balancing them with aesthetic aspirations ensures a satisfactory outcome. According to The Spruce, sheetrock costs around $16 to $17 per 4-by-8 sheet (1/2-inch thick) or $0.50 to $0.55 per square foot, though prices can vary, highlighting the importance of factoring material costs into the overall project budget.

        Mastering the Application Techniques
       
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              &#xD;
&l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Perfecting the art of feathering is essential in achieving flawless sheetrock finishes. Feathering involves gradually thinning the edges of the joint compound for a seamless transition between drywall and tape. This technique eliminates abrupt differences in thickness, preventing unsightly lines or ridges. Practice and a keen eye for detail allow for mastery of feathering, ultimately contributing to the professionalism of the finished product. Effective feathering leads to walls that are both aesthetically pleasing and structurally sound.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Achieving seamless joints is a fundamental goal of sheetrock taping. It requires attention to detail and an understanding of compound application techniques. Ensuring adequate layers, with careful smoothing of each, eliminates the potential for visible seams and joints. Proper drying time between layers is critical to prevent cracking and shrinkage. Frequent inspections during the process promote the identification and correction of minor imperfections before they become noticeable problems.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          The use of trowels and knives significantly affects the outcome of the taping process. Selecting the right tool size can influence the efficiency and ease of application, with wider knives ideal for extensive areas and smaller ones preferred for detailed work. Regular maintenance of these tools, including cleaning and edge sharpening, enhances their performance and longevity. Mastery of these instruments allows for a uniform application of compound, crucial for the final appearance of the walls.         Troubleshooting Common Taping Issues
       
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              
              &#xD;
&lt;/h3&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Tackling bubble formation is a frequent challenge in sheetrock taping. Bubbles can occur due to inadequate adhesion or the presence of air pockets beneath the tape. Techniques such as reapplying the joint compound and using a knife to smooth out air pockets can resolve this issue. Consistent practice and inspection during application help identify and correct bubbling early in the process. Over time, developing a strategic approach reduces the occurrence of bubbles, leading to more reliable finishes.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Cracking and shrinkage are additional concerns that can mar the appearance of finished walls. These issues typically arise from improper compound mixing or applying layers that are too thick. Ensuring the right consistency of joint compound and adhering to recommended drying times alleviates these problems. In some cases, additives or specialized compounds designed to minimize shrinkage can be beneficial. Addressing these issues promptly is crucial to maintaining the integrity and durability of the wall finish.
         
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  
                  &#xD;
    &lt;/span&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    &lt;span&gt;&#xD;
      
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
                    
          Uneven seams can detract from the visual appeal of finished walls, necessitating corrective measures. Remedies include sanding down high spots and applying additional thin layers of joint compound to low areas. Using a bright light at an angle during inspections can illuminate imperfections, guiding corrective actions. Consistency in compound application and attention to detail are key to preventing uneven seams. By refining these techniques, even novice DIYers can achieve a polished, professional appearance in their projects.

           Skim coating is another popular drywall finish that involves applying a thin layer of joint compound over the surface of the drywall. This technique smooths out any bumps, cracks, or other imperfections, creating an ultra-smooth, flawless surface. Skim coating is particularly useful for older walls or when you're looking to refresh the look of your home without replacing the entire drywall.
